巨大口蘑液体发酵条件优化研究

Optimizing the fermentation conditions of Tricholoma giganteum
原文传递
导出
摘要 通过单因素和均匀设计对巨大口蘑液体菌种发酵工艺条件进行了优化,研究结果表明,巨大口蘑液体发酵最佳条件为:装液量179mL、摇床转速165r/min、发酵温度28℃、初始pH6、接种量为4片直径1.2cm的菌丝块,干菌丝量达到0.8626g。通过实验研究,得到了巨大口蘑液体发酵的最佳条件,为今后巨大口蘑液体菌种的生产提供理论依据。 The optimization of liquid shake-flask fermentation conditions of Tricholoma giganteum was studied by single factor experiment and uniform design method. The results showed that the optimal liquid shake-flask fermentation conditions Tricholoma giganteum were as follows.volume was 179mL medium in 250mL flask, rotate speed was 165r/min,cultivation temperature was 28℃, pH was 6 and the inoculum size was 4 pieces of 1.2cm sclertium in diameter. The weight of dry mycelia achieved to 0.8626g. Through the experiment research, liquid optimal fermentation conditions of Tricholoma giganteum was obtained,theoretical basis would be provided for the future Tricholoma giganteum liquid strain production.
